Advocacy
As part of the largest military advocacy organization, the National Guard Association of the United States, the VNGA works to transform our members’ ideas into legislative action and provide states and our members unified representation before members of the General Assembly, the U.S. Congress and their staff on the association’s priorities.

Member Benefits
Aside from the Virginia National Guard voice VNGA brings to Richmond and Washington, D.C., members also enjoy a variety of benefits that include everything from insurance and other life enhancing programs to various discounts and privileges with a variety of VNGA business partners.

National Guard State Sponsored Life Insurance
The State Sponsored Life Insurance (SSLI) program provides group term life insurance exclusively for actively serving members of the Army and Air National Guard organizations and their dependents. The program is derived from United States Public Law 93-289, May 24, 1974, to encourage persons to join and remain in the National Guard.
